photo removal.

My players photos are in the bottom left corner of the screen, but they are taking up too much space and blocking my view of the map. Is there a way to remove or resize them. As far as I know they don't really serve a purpose.

Adrian, go to the Sidebar Menu and then to the Settings Tab. Scroll down until you find "Video + Voice" section and under "Video/Player Avatar Size:" you can change the size of the portraits. NOTE: If you select "Names Only" while running Roll20 normally (not through Google Hangouts) you will not be able to use voice chat, because this deactivates TokBox. If you're in Google Hangouts, portrait size is usually automatically switched to "Names Only", but this doesn't affect the video/audio because Hangouts UI handles it.
